  • Hi folks.
    When Pets in Prospect first came out I contacted the local library. It seems their Service Development Department has been networking over the past two months. As a result I've now been asked to speak at Porlock and Frome Literary Festivals.  Brochures with book details and pic will be printed. Then yesterday I was phoned by Somerset Library Services to ask if I could speak at four other venues in Somerset and South Gloucestershire through the summer and autumn. Each one will get publicised in the local press. I just hope I can live up to expectations otherwise there's going to be a lot of disappointed folk out there - assuming that people will turn up for these events.
    I mention all of this to illustrate the value of contacting as many people as possible re your work as you never know where it might lead.
    And that initial phone call of mine?  It was to tentatively ask whether the local library might consider stocking a copy of Pets in Prospect.
